[Bug 32222] Potential cyclic references when using request and handle

bugzilla-daemon at freedesktop.org bugzilla-daemon at freedesktop.org
Thu Dec 9 13:11:02 CET 2010


https://bugs.freedesktop.org/show_bug.cgi?id=32222

--- Comment #6 from Xavier Claessens <xclaesse at gmail.com> 2010-12-09 04:11:02 PST ---
I know understand better how it was supposed to work: ref is kept on TpChannel
only in the case we are an handler. In that case caller is responsible to call
Close() on the channel to make it invalidated which will break the ref cycle.

Here is a branch documenting this and fixing a real leak:

git://git.collabora.co.uk/git/user/xclaesse/telepathy-glib.git

-- 
Configure bugmail: https://bugs.freedesktop.org/userprefs.cgi?tab=email
------- You are receiving this mail because: -------
You are the QA contact for the bug.
You are the assignee for the bug.



More information about the telepathy-bugs mailing list